Hybrid Fibre Coaxial  - HFC


 

1. Check for Outages

  • Click Here to Visit NBN Co's network status page to check for any reported outages in your area.
  • If there’s an outage, wait until it’s resolved.

2.  Inspect the Equipment

  • Ensure all cables are securely connected to the NBN Connection Box, your router, and the wall socket.
  • Check for visible damage to cables or connectors.

3.  Power Cycle Your Equipment

  • Turn off the NBN Connection Box (pictured Above) and your router.
  • Wait for 2 minutes.
  • Turn on the NBN Connection Box first, wait for the lights to stabilize, then turn on the router.

4.  Check the Indicator Lights on the NBN Connection Box

  • Power: Should be solid green. If not, check the power connection.
  • Downstream (DS): Should be solid or blinking green. If off, please contact us, this might indicate a signal issue. Contact our helpdesk so we can check this further
  • Upstream (US): Should be solid or blinking green. If off, please contact us, this might indicate a connection issue.
  • Online: Should be solid green. If blinking or off, the connection to the NBN network might be down.
  • LAN: Should blink when data is being transmitted to your router.

5. Check Your Router

  • Make sure the following lights are on or blinking on your Router: WAN + Wi-Fi + Internet

6.  Reboot Your Devices

  • Restart any devices connected to the internet, such as computers, tablets.

7.  Test Your Internet Connection

  • Connect a device directly to the router using an Ethernet cable to test the connection. This helps rule out Wi-Fi issues.

8.  Check for Wi-Fi Issues

  • Ensure you’re within range of your Wi-Fi router.
  • Restart your router if the Wi-Fi signal is weak or intermittent.
  • Change the Wi-Fi channel in your router settings if you suspect interference.

9.  Perform a Factory Reset (if necessary)

  • If problems persist, reset your router to factory settings. Use a paperclip to press and hold the reset button on your router for 10-30 seconds (check your router’s manual for exact instructions). Note: This will erase all custom settings.
